Output 31e268bade0b0a60fedbfba230bcf62e652b005743beec7d972037b4d1ce3f44:1

value
321264698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e69bb72d3bd8acac09d799a3cbd7a496a84f420 OP_EQUAL
address
3DDRj7npF9N9bv7kbJpa3vXhM6Pcyhtagr
transaction
31e268bade0b0a60fedbfba230bcf62e652b005743beec7d972037b4d1ce3f44
spent
true